The bird in hand view is OK, BUT as something I have learned over the years of educating myself (yes, our public education system has failed all of us) on personal finance, this is not always the best approach for everyone. There is a saying that "personal finance" is personal, there is no one size fits all. SS collecting age is no exception. I for one am planning on 70 mainly as longevity insurance for my partner who likely will outlive me. I want to leave as much lifetime cashflow so expensive "old people expenses" such as health care and assisted living are covered. Taking SS at 62 just does not cut it for me. Now, we will evaluate annually , so things can change, of course. Flexibility is important. And all this SS fear is simply FUD BS. Yes, i don't trust the government when it comes to doing the best for us , BUT I have EVERY CONFIDENCE in the government's desire of SELF PRESERVATION. Any sane politician will want to be seen as solving the SS shortfall issue coming right around the corner - SS benefits won't be reduced, at least not for us Gen X so close to 'retirement'.

Too many comments here about having to plan ahead because SS is going away. SS is not going away as it’s a pay as you go system funded by the current workforce. With the trust fund projected to be depleted in a few years benefit levels will be cut by over 20% but with current workers paying the payroll tax retirees will receive their earned SS benefits, it’s just that it will be at reduced levels unless there is a fix by Congress.
